Output 64ab496759a568e8177c7c305efd67f900154649377e08807f779f44615ea508:6

value
53191489
script pubkey
OP_0 OP_PUSHBYTES_20 b63dfa75d57e060413a70f2435b467f05c1008bf
address
ltc1qkc7l5aw40crqgya8pujrtdr87pwpqz9lxgyjxn
transaction
64ab496759a568e8177c7c305efd67f900154649377e08807f779f44615ea508
spent
true